SDCL § 37-37-4: Refund to be made to consumer and any lien holders--Allowance for use.

  1. TITLE 37. TRADE REGULATION
  2. CHAPTER 37-37. FARM MACHINERY LEMON LAW

Refunds shall be made to the consumer and any lien holders, as their interests may appear. There shall be offset against any monetary recovery of the consumer a reasonable allowance for the consumer's use of the farm machinery. A reasonable allowance for use is that amount directly attributable to use by the consumer before the consumer's first report of the nonconformity to the manufacturer or authorized dealer.
